Fuzzy Wuzzy

Fuzzy Logic is a way that computers copy the way that humans think and solve problems. Instead of only have a few alternatives for something, Fuzzy Logic uses rules based on experiences, which is what the human brain does as well. Fuzzy is a lot cheaper to produce and has a wider range of choices that it can make. The first person to come up with the idea of fuzzy was someone who worked at the University of California at Berkeley. Then Japan took on the idea and China soon after, both this countries made many of these smart machines.
